Momote Airport (IATA: MAS, ICAO: AYMO) serves Manus Island, PG. It has 3 scheduled routes to 3 destinations in 1 countries, operated by 1 airlines.
- New Terminal Building: The airport boasts a massive new state-of-the-art terminal that opened in April 2022, designed to resemble a stingray. It includes VIP, departure, and arrival lounges, check-in counters, baggage screening machines, and CCTVs.
- Enhanced Facilities: The upgraded airport features an improved aircraft runway pavement with an asphalt surfacing finish, a runway extension from 1,810 meters to 2,010 meters, and a new power station. A new airport market building and an airfield lighting system are also part of the modernization.
- International Flight Readiness: The new facility includes on-arrival VISA and Immigration counters to process foreign passengers, and the airport parking bay can accommodate one Boeing 737-800 series aircraft and two Fokker 100 aircraft simultaneously, indicating readiness for potential direct international flights.
- Efficient Security and Immigration: Predicted wait times for security and immigration are relatively short, estimated at around 7 minutes each, leading to a total queue time of approximately 14 minutes.
- Basic Amenities: The airport offers check-in counters, baggage handling, and waiting areas. While not extensive, amenities like lounges, dining and shopping, currency exchange, and free WiFi are listed as available.
- Limited International Service: Despite being termed "international," its international service is limited, primarily handling domestic flights to and from Port Moresby.
- Transportation Confirmation: Travelers are advised to confirm transportation from the airport in advance, especially for late arrivals, as options typically include taxis or pre-arranged transport with accommodation.

Where is Momote Airport located?
Momote Airport is located in Manus Island, PG, at an elevation of 12 ft. Its IATA code is MAS and ICAO code is AYMO.
